Haudenosaunee Cycle of Ceremonies The Mohawk Nation at Kahnawà:ke, as Haudenosaunee people, follow a familiar cycle of ceremonies that define the spiritual foundation of our people. Haudenosaunee spirituality dwells on our duty and responsibility to be thankful to the natural world which provides for our health and well-being.
The Mohawk people are the most easterly tribe of the Haudenosaunee, or Iroquois Confederacy. Iroquoian-speaking indigenous people of North America, with communities in northern New York State and southeastern Canada, primarily around Lake Ontario and the St Lawrence River. There are currently seven Iroquoian languages spoken, all of which are found in the U.S.A., and all but Cherokee in Canada. As can be seen from the population table, all the languages except Cherokee and Mohawk are in imminant danger of extinction, and all languages are spoken by less than 10% of their respective nation's population. The French colonists called the Haudenosaunee by the name of Iroquois. There are several different places this name might have come from: French transliteration of irinakhoiw, a Huron (Wyandot) name for the Haudenosaunee. Used in a negative way, it meant "black snakes" or "real adders". The Haudenosaunee and Huron were traditional enemies, as ...
